Decoding the Xiaomi SU7 Sealing System: The Silent Fortress Built with Millimeter-Perfect Seals

In the quest for acoustic excellence in electric vehicles, sealing systems have emerged as a critical battleground. The Xiaomi SU7 deploys a ​multi-tiered defense network comprising 27 specialized sealing components, achieving cabin quietness that outperforms rivals by 3-5 dB(A). I. Polymer Precision: Core Materials Engineering

The SU7’s sealing strategy leverages six advanced polymers across static and dynamic applications:

1. Structural Seals

  • Modified Epoxy Structural Adhesive: 80%+ elongation at break (industry avg: 60%) enables 0.02mm-scale gap sealing across 120+ meters of application
  • Butyl Rubber Hem Seal: Blocks moisture ingress (<0.4g/m²·day vapor transmission = 1 water droplet penetration per 5 years)
  • PVC Weld Seam Sealer: 93% elastic recovery withstands body flexure

2. Dynamic Contact Seals​ (4-door system exemplar)

Seal Tier Core Material Performance Leap
Primary Seal High-Durometer EPDM (Shore 65±3) 15% compression set (70°C/22h)
Secondary Seal EPDM/Acoustic Foam Composite 30dB sound insulation (1-4kHz)
Glass Run Channel Micro-Flocked TPE 0.15 friction coefficient (vs. 0.35 in rubber)

Note: Total seal length per door = 7.5m; precision flocking thickness control at 0.5±0.05mm


II. Extreme-Duty Seals: Molecular Defense

Mission-critical seals meet military-grade protocols:

  • Battery Seal: Dual-durometer FKM (70HA body / 85HA lip) passes ​85°C high-pressure spray testing​ (IPX9K)
  • Motor Shaft Seal: PTFE-coated HNBR with 3x wear resistance
  • Charge Port Seal: Liquid Silicone Rubber (LSR) maintains elasticity at -40°C

Validation Milestone: Battery seals retain <18% compression set after 2000 thermal cycles (-40°C ↔ 85°C)


III. Performance Benchmark: Air Tightness Data

Vehicle Air Leakage Comparison (50Pa Differential Pressure)​

Vehicle Class Air Tightness (SCFM) Equivalent Leak Area 120km/h Wind Noise
Mainstream EV 3.5-4.2 ≈21cm² 64dB(A)
Luxury ICE 2.8-3.5 ≈17cm² 61dB(A)
Xiaomi SU7 ​≤1.2 ​≤7.2cm² 57dB(A)​

(SCFM = Standard Cubic Feet per Minute; lower = better sealing)


IV. Nano-Scale Engineering Breakthroughs

  • Molecular Design: 30nm clay nanoparticles boost EPDM wear resistance by 50%
  • Micron Tolerance: Glass-channel clearance ±0.3mm (industry std: ±0.8mm)
  • Smart Compensation: Frameless door channels feature pressure-equalizing air ducts (0.2s seal engagement)

V. Strategic Sealing Advantages

  1. Acoustic Premium: 53.2 dB(A) at 60km/h (library-quiet cabin)
  2. Range Optimization: Superior air tightness reduces HVAC load, adding ​12-15km WLTP range
  3. Longevity Assurance: Critical seals validated for 240,000km (2x national standards)
